Diverter/bypass Valve

I just bought a 2007 Cooper S. The CEL came on and the code it was throwing was p28AA diverter/bypass valve plausibility. My car does not have the response it once had now that it is in LIMP MODE... Can anyone direct me to where I go next, replace etc. I have looked and cant seem to find the answer anywhere. Please help me out.

Replace it.

The diaphragm inside the DV is most likely torn. I believe that the N14 2007-2010 used a DV that is now upgraded on the N18 models 2011-2013...

Check sites like WMW, Out Motoring, Etc.. Good luck and enjoy the install, it can be a B!$@£ at first LOL...

Have you ever been in a MCS that had the Forge deverter valve? The purpose behind the Forge DV is that it reacts much faster than the stock DV, the stock DV dumps more boost than is nessisary. Your turbo using the Forge DV increases your turbos responsiveness and you dump less boost in between shifts. Just ask anyone who owns the Forge DV, they will tell you the same thing.
